Artist Statement:
I am a Bay Area-based artist drawn to the luminous, jewel-like quality of the medium of encaustic and its boundless creative potential. My work explores the intersection of personal, social, and political themes, often incorporating photographic and drawn imagery to weave a narrative. Saudade (a Portuguese word denoting mournful yearning), is both a tribute to my octogenarian parents who were high school sweethearts, and a reflection on the universal experiences of innocence, hope, and youthful romance.
Throughout a lifetime, we accumulate cherished yet fading memories, intimate
connections, and treasured mementos. Nostalgia offers comfort as time marches unrelentingly forward, leading us toward an uncertain future until we take our last breath. Remembering the “good old days” is a bittersweet experience—we crave the past while knowing it is forever out of reach. Saudade encapsulates this complex emotional landscape, capturing the longing, joy, and melancholy that are fundamental to the human experience.
